Several years ago I was involved in a single blind listening test of power cords. My second favorite cord was an Extreme from Audio Magic. I was suprised that a $99 power cord could sound so good. It was the winner of a bang for buck comparison...but not the best sounding cord of the night. But I remembered this comparison.

Well this year I needed some power cords for a re vamped system since the Belden cords were not cutting it on my power amps. So I called Audio Magic since the price of the Extreme PC has gone up to $150. But I found out they made some significant improvements. First of all the guage oif wiring has been stepped up from 16 to 10. Which bodes well for my amps. Second of all the new cords are double dipped silver over copper. The old ones were also, but I think Jerry upped the amount of silver being used. Finally, they are triple shielded. So I bought three of them.

It took about 96 hours to get through the initial burn in. But these things sound great in my system, and are getting better as time passes. You get very nice detail and focus. Highs have lots of resolution without being grainy. Bass is quick too. There does seem to be a bit of forwardness in the upper midrange, but in my system this is not a problem. And hey this is a 150 buck power cord. Overall I am very pleased with the new version. It still offers great bang for the buck. And my current system really is about bang for the buck...not perfect sound....since my pockets arent deep enough for that at this time. But I find that the strengths of these power cords fit my system very well.

There are two downsides to the Extreme cords. First of all, they come only in 2 meter lengths, nothing else. Secondly the ends are not super fancy Marcino's or Watt Gates. You get an average looking end, but they appear to do the job. So there is no audio "Bling" factor with these.

Ok, so there are cheaper power cords out there, can't argue that. But from my experiences, I think you are going to be hard pressed to find a better cord at this price range.
